Actress Eva Mendes has launched her spring 2014 fashion collection with New York & Company, at two events in California earlier this week.
New York & Co. had Mendes as guest of honour at the opening of its new Beverly Center pop-up store at 8500 Beverly Boulevard on Tuesday, while on Wednesday, she celebrated her spring collection with NY&C customers at Los Cerritos Center.
The earlier event saw guests use Instagram with a hashtag, #EvaMendesNYC, to update a live feed at the store, while the later one saw Mendes pose with the first 75 customers who bought from her collection.
NY&C says that Mendes was inspired by New York in the spring. The collection features ‘rich blues, oranges, vintage floral prints, and soft, earthy tones.’ Mendes was also inspired by family archives and vintage pieces.
The range hit stores on March 19, on- and offline, with accessories priced from US$22·95 to US$35·95, separates at US$46·95, US$59·95, and US$64·95, and dresses from US$79·95.
